Structural, electronic and optical properties of copper, …

3.1 Anilite (Cu 7 S 4). Several polymorphs of copper sulfide, of general formula Cu x S (1 ≤ x ≤ 2), have been characterized. In these structures, the location of Cu atoms in the close-packed S lattice is not well identified and their positions change as a function of the composition (x).In a copper-rich environment, the experimentally …

Copper(II) sulfide | CuS | CID 14831

Modify: . Description. Covellite is a mineral with formula of Cu 1+ S or CuS. The IMA symbol is Cv. RRUFF Project. Copper (II) sulfide is a chemical compound of copper and sulfur. It occurs in nature as the mineral covellite. Copper is a chemical element with the symbol Cu and atomic number 29.

Copper Sulfide

Copper sulfide minerals require the use of acid and an oxidizing agent to break the mineral lattice and release Cu2+ into solution ( Sherrit, Pavlides, & Weekes, 2005 ). Elemental copper found in nature can be leached by either oxygen or ferric ion: (15.6a) Metallic copper: Cu + 0.5 O 2 + H 2 SO 4 → Cu 2 + + SO 4 2 − + H 2 O.

The Extraction of Copper

The method used to extract copper from its ores depends on the nature of the ore. Sulfide ores such as chalcopyrite ( CuFeS2 C u F e S 2) are converted to copper by a different method from silicate, carbonate or sulfate ores. Chalcopyrite (also known as copper pyrites) and similar sulfide ores are the commonest ores of copper.
